Police Officers and Criminals arrested in BiH because of SKY Devices

Published: November 1, 2022
Share
SHARE

In Bosnia and Herzegovina (BiH), over the past year, dozens of people suspected of drug trafficking, weapons, and murder have been arrested as a result of investigations into the use of SKY and ANOM mobile devices.

Among them are police officers, and suspects of drug trafficking, weapons, and prostitution. Some of them used these devices, and the messages they exchanged through them were deciphered by foreign police agencies.

They submitted them to the Prosecutor’s Office of BiH, which initiated investigations in which the police arrested, among others, the chief police inspector of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the Republika Srpska (RS), a state police officer who protected the building of the Presidency of BiH, and the head of the regional office of the Intelligence – Security Agency of BiH.

Keljmendi’s group was destroyed

Denis Stojnic, MMA fighter (mixed martial arts) and restaurant owner in the center of Sarajevo, is the last to be detained in the case opened by the BiH Prosecutor’s Office on the basis of deciphered SKY messages.

Stojnic is the best man of Elvis Keljmendi, who was detained in a police operation on July 12th, 2022, also as part of the investigation that was launched based on the use of SKY devices.

Moreover, Adis Prasovic, a senior inspector in the criminal police sector in Sarajevo, and police officer Amer Selak were also detained in this operation. They are suspected of money laundering, accepting gifts, and helping the perpetrator of a crime.

Drugs, prostitution, killing a policeman

In mid-November 2021, after the decryption of SKY messages, Bojan Cvijetic, a former advisor to the former Minister of State Security of BiH Dragan Mektic, was also detained.

Mladen Milovanovic, the inspector of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the RS, was also arrested then. They are charged, among other things, with drug trafficking and helping criminal persons.

On April 13th, 2022, State Investigation and Protection Agency (SIPA) members detained Jovan Savic, judge of the Basic Court in Bijeljina. The BiH Prosecutor’s Office charges him with ”receiving a bribe for revealing an official secret”, that is, cooperating with a suspect in organized crime. In addition to Judge Savic, 17 other people were detained in the operation for drug smuggling.

At the same time, officers of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the RS detained Dalibor Railic at the end of March 2022, who, according to the BiH Prosecutor’s Office, is connected to the serious murder of Prijedor Criminal Police Chief Radenko Basic.

Dejan Jurisic, a police officer from Prijedor, was also taken into custody. He is suspected of having information that the assassination of Chief Basic was being planned, as well as of persons preparing the assassination, but that he did not pass it on to the authorities. Instead of protecting citizens, as stated in the indictment, he maintained contact with criminal persons.

Nedeljko Lubara, the chief inspector of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the RS, was also detained in August of this year due to contact with suspected criminals. In the same month, Robert Radonjic, head of the office of the Intelligence – Security Agency of BiH in Banja Luka, was also detained, Radio Slobodna Evropa reports.
